Quick question, I have an old iPhone 4s and my buddy wants to buy it off me but he is with Fido(Canadian provider) and the phone is locked with Telus(Canadian Provider) I know it isn't easy doing so but I know that people unlock phone all the time. So my question is, is their any way to switch the phone to be compatible with Fido?

 Contact Telus and ask nicely, according the the CRTC they must be able to provide an unlock after 90 days of owning a phone.

Ask Telus. There's laws in place that require them to have to unlock your phone. There's a fee however, usually 50 bucks or so.
